CWGC added the following casualty to its database today.

TAYLOR, Richard

Sjt 02014 Royal Army Service Corps

Died 20.04.21 Age 49

Commemorated: United Kingdom Book of Remembrance

NOT FORGOTTEN

The above was an In From the Cold Project case:

- Sjt Taylor died post-discharge of tuberculosis (Volunteer: Tony Emptage)

TAYLOR, RICHARD Rank: Serjeant Service No: 02014 Date of Death: 20/04/1921 Age: 49 Regiment/Service: Royal Army Service Corps Grave Reference Cemetery CLEETHORPES CEMETERY Additional Information:

Son of Elizabeth Taylor, of Cleethorpes.

Commemoration Moved From UK BOR
